Gillian is a unisex name of English, Gaelic and Latin origin. Meaning in English: Child of the gods. A feminine form of Julian, meaning Jove’s child. Meaning in Gaelic: A Scottish Gaelic name meaning St. John’s servant. Meaning in Latin: Youthful. Jove’s child. Variant of Juliana. Gillian is a feminine form of Julian. The name has 7 letters.
